我有布尔字段在行动
testMeAction.class
private boolean testMe;
// with setter and getter.
testMeAction-validation.xml中
<!DOCTYPE validators PUBLIC "-//OpenSymphony Group//XWork Validator 1.0.2//EN" "http://www.opensymphony.com/xwork/xwork-validator-1.0.2.dtd">
<validators>
<validator type="expression" short-circuit="true">
<param name="expression"><![CDATA[(testMe == false)]]></param>
<message key="user.message" />
</validator>
</validators>
我想在testMe = false;
时验证并显示消息
但由于某种原因,它始终显示消息,testMe
的价值是什么。
如果我出错了,请有人建议。